Extreme Heat Warning Monday Afternoon – Early Tuesday Evening

The National Weather Service Milwaukee/Sullivan Weather Forecast Office has issued an EXTREME HEAT WARNING beginning Monday afternoon through early Tuesday evening.

Hot and humid conditions are expected Monday through Friday with heat index values reaching as high as 106 degrees F in our area on Monday afternoon. Overnight heat index values will remain in the 70s, offering little reprieve from the heat.

Hot and humid conditions may linger into the Independence Day holiday weekend.
